Granville "Buddy" Taylor
Granville "Buddy" Taylor
Class of 1962
Army, 2 Years

Served as a Personnel Specialist from 1967-1969. Stateside the whole tour of duty. Basic at Fort Polk and AIT at Fort Jackson, then permanent party at Fort Jackson dealing with incomin personnel for basic training. Used IBM Key Punch; computers were just becoming popular when I go out.
